Life and Work with Autumn Gregory

Today we’d like to introduce you to Autumn Gregory.

Autumn, please share your story with us. How did you get to where you are today?
I have always been fasinated with cosmetology since a very young age. iGLAM, which stands for I Give Life After Makeovers, took off after I was involved in an abusive relationship. During that time, makeup became therapeutic for me as a way to cope with my situation. I was able to be creative and look better than I felt. After I was able to get out of that relationship and heal, I began to volunteer at battered women shelters and teach makeup classes while sharing my story. It’s not just about dressing up a pretty face, makeup is a ministry to me.
